They celebrated International Children’s Rights Day

Suwałki

International Children’s Rights Day was celebrated together with UNICEF by students of the Primary School. Maria Konopnicka in Suwałki. Yesterday was the anniversary of the adoption of the “Convention on the Rights of the Child”.

SPMK has prepared many actions on this occasion. Students came dressed in blue and could also take part in knowledge competitions on children’s rights. Teachers conducted lessons on this topic, drawing attention to the fact that children’s rights are entitled to every young person without exception and should be respected by every adult.

– On the occasion of the holiday, we reminded children about the figure of Janusz Korczak. He was a pioneer of children’s rights. His memory is also honored in our city with a bust, which is located in the center of Suwałki – emphasizes the director of the facility, Jadwiga Orłowska.

The Convention on the Rights of the Child, adopted in 1989, guarantees equality before the law for all children. International Children’s Rights Day with UNICEF is an event that unites all children in the world. On this day, in many countries, children and adults take joint initiatives.

Every year, UNICEF invites you to use the color blue in all possible activities undertaken on International Children’s Rights Day as a symbol of solidarity with all children in the world, including those whose rights are not respected.
